a circumference of jupiter is approximately 272,946 miles. earth is approximately 24,901 miles. what is a scale factor of jupiter to earth round to the nearest whole number

The scale factor of Jupiter to Earth can be found by dividing the circumference of Jupiter by the circumference of Earth:
Scale factor = Circumference of Jupiter / Circumference of Earth
Scale factor = 272,946 miles / 24,901 miles
Scale factor ≈ 10.96
Rounded to the nearest whole number, the scale factor of Jupiter to Earth is 11.
